pdmaner连不上PGsql
时间: 2025-01-01 17:23:51 浏览: 6
### PDMan 连接 PostgreSQL 数据库失败解决方案
当遇到PDMan连接PostgreSQL数据库失败的情况时,可以按照以下方法排查和解决问题。
#### 配置数据库连接参数
确保在PDMan中的数据库连接配置正确无误。对于PostgreSQL而言,URL应遵循特定格式,并且需要指定正确的驱动类名[^3]。例如:
| 参数 | 值 |
| --- | --- |
| URL | `jdbc:postgresql://localhost:5432/your_database_name` |
| Driver Class Name | `org.postgresql.Driver` |
如果不确定具体的端口号或数据库名称,请查阅PostgreSQL服务器的相关设置。
#### 安装JDBC驱动程序
为了使PDMan能够成功访问PostgreSQL数据库,还需要下载对应的JDBC驱动文件(通常为`.jar`),并将此文件放置于PDMan应用程序目录下的适当位置,通常是`lib`文件夹内[^4]。
#### 测试网络连通性
确认客户端机器与运行着目标PostgreSQL实例的服务端之间具有良好的TCP/IP通信能力。可以通过命令行工具ping来初步验证两者间的可达性;更进一步的话,则可利用telnet尝试建立至默认监听端口(即5432)上的连接。
#### 查看日志信息
一旦上述准备工作完成却依旧无法正常工作,建议查看PDMan的日志记录寻找线索。这些日志往往包含了详细的错误描述以及堆栈跟踪信息,有助于定位具体原因所在[^1]。
```bash
# 使用 psql 工具测试连接
psql -h localhost -p 5432 -U your_username -d your_dbname
```
通过以上措施应该能有效提高PDMan同PostgreSQL之间的兼容性和稳定性,从而顺利实现二者间的数据交互操作。
阅读全文